The OJK uses a tank surrounded by an oil jacket filled with heat transfer oil. The heat transfer
oil is heated by a diesel fired burner and is circulated in the oil jacket by a pump. In addition to
the oil jacket there is a coil surrounding the agitating auger in the tank. Heat transfer oil is
pumped through this coil to facilitate heating of the asphalt material. The temperature of the
product and the heat transfer oil is automatically maintained by electronic temperature con-
trols.
The heated asphalt is applied to the crack by an electrically heated hose and wand. The heat-
ing element in the hose and wand keep the product at working temperature thus eliminating
wand "freeze up". No clean-up or flushing of the wand & hose is required.
Power is supplied by a diesel engine. The engine drives a 24 volt alternator for the heated
hose and wand. It also drives a hydraulic pump that powers the heat transfer oil circulation
pump, product pump, and the agitating auger.
